MQTT协议发送与订阅消息,测试工具用MQTTLents(可在谷歌市场下载-fanqiang方法自找)

此教程是MQTT + apache-apollo服务器使用

所需工具:http://activemq.apache.org/apollo/download.html

选择对应版本,我这里用的是Windows10,下载好后解压到相应目录,打开bin位置的apollo.cmd,注意,这个文件闪退是jdk没装,jdk版本不能太高否则后续会出现安装错误,建议1.8.

1,打开apollo.cmd文件会出现一个小窗口。

2.接下来去到相对应的目录下,win+r快速打开命令窗口。

3.创建在c盘目录的命令是:apollo create myapollo C:\apache-apollo\broker, ,创建完broker之后c盘会出现下列文件:

4.进入C:\apache-apollo\broker\bin目录下,执行如下命令:apollo-broker run

执行成功如图所示,若有失败提示则是jdk安装版本过高。

5.现在可以在浏览器上访问主页了,输入http://127.0.0.1:61680即可,用户名默认是admin密码是password。

成功页面:

接下来就是消息的测试和发送了,现在主要说两种测试工具,MqttLents和Mqtt.fx。

在谷歌浏览器设置里 更多程序-拓展工具里搜索MqttLents。

安装成功后在屏幕我的程序里可找到打开。

新建连接这些不多讲,如上图,(用户密码别忘了填,也是admin和password,其它的部分不用管),端口号是在网页端查询:

成功如下图:

MQTT.fx工具自行下载,使用教程:

1.

2.

3.

连接成功如下显示:

更多关于mqtt.fx的使用教程可咨询度娘。

完结。

ps:工作做的第一份任务,从安卓开发转到物联网开发,挑战仍在继续,后面会改用Linux,详情请期待后续。

共勉。

猜你喜欢

转载自blog.csdn.net/hrawi/article/details/81539330